You are confusing strobe-like flashing with frame rate. TVs typically display a frame rate of 24fps, but actually flash at a much higher frequency (anything from 50Hz, to 960Hz on newer plasma TVs). Some TVs/monitors actually flash each line one at a time (interlaced scanning), some flash the entire image at once (progressive scanning).

The Hobbit was filmed at 48fps instead of 24, but this has nothing to do with flashing - this is simply the frame rate (ie the still image changes 48 times per second). The actual refresh rate would depend on the projector used. It does look different, many newer TVs have a "100Hz" refresh rate which basically gives the same effect - The picture looks a lot smoother when there is fast movement on the screen. Personally I don't like the effect, I prefer the standard 24fps (it can look flickery when there is movement, but I think it just looks better).
